Bourg-de-Bigorre is a French commune with 197 inhabitants (as of January 1, 2017) in the Hautes-Pyrénées department in the Occitanie region (before 2016: Midi-Pyrénées ). The municipality belongs to the arrondissement of Bagnères-de-Bigorre and the canton of La Vallée de l'Arros et des Baïses (until 2015: canton of Lannemezan ).
The inhabitants are called Bourgeais and Bourgeaises .
geography
Bourg-de-Bigorre is located about ten kilometers east-northeast of Bagnères-de-Bigorre in the historic vice-county of Nébouzan .

Population development
After records began, the population rose to a high of around 800 by the first half of the 19th century. In the following period, the size of the community fell to a low of around 175 with brief recovery phases by the 1990s. A phase one followed Up and down around a population of around 190, which continues to this day.

Economy and Infrastructure
Bourg-de-Bigorre is located in the AOC zones of the Porc noir de Bigorre pig breed and the Jambon noir de Bigorre ham .
education
The municipality has a public pre-school and elementary school with 50 students in the 2019/2020 school year.
sport and freetime
- The long-distance hiking trail GR 78, called La voie des Piémonts , leads from Carcassonne to Saint-Jean-Pied-de-Port also through the center of Bourg-de-Bigorre. It is considered the Camino de Santiago alongside the four main routes in France.
- The regional long-distance hiking trail GR de Pays Tour des Baronnies de Bigorre runs parallel to the GR 79 and also leads through the center of the municipality.
traffic
Bourg-de-Bigorre can be reached via Routes départementales 14, 84, 326 and 484.
